2-adrenergic receptor redistribution in heart failure changes cAMP compartmentation
Here we combined topographical imaging with localized application of agonists via nanopipette and fluorescence resonance energy transfer to uncover the mechanisms leading to the abnormal cAMP compartmentation in heart failure. These findings are of great importance for the development of new strategies for heart failure treatment. The work was featured in Editor’s choice in Science Signaling 3(115), 2010, p93 and Perspective in Science 327(5973), 2010, p1586. The work originated from a project funded by Wellcome Trust (090594/Z/09/Z) and lead to Imperial College Research Excellence Award. The study also helped secure follow-up BHF New Horizons grant (NH/10/3/28574).
